Bank of Zambia Circular 10/1998: Introduction to the Euro

The Bank of Zambia requires all commercial banks to prepare for and familiarize themselves with the Euro as an additional major operating currency ahead of its legal introduction on 1 January 1999. During the three-year transition period ending 31 December 2001, participating European national currencies will coexist with the Euro before physical banknotes and coins replace them in January 2002.
